Next, weigh out the soapmaking oils and butters using a digital scale . Combine in a … WebMay 27, 2024 · A light oil that you can use in your soap recipe at up to 5%. Grapeseed Oil Grapeseed oil has lots of linoleic acid. It can be used at up to 15% in soap making. Green Tea Seed Oil This nutrient-rich oil can be used in your soap recipe at up to 6%. Hazelnut Oil This oil is low in essential fatty acids, therefore it is slow to reach trace. WebMay 26, 2016 · Pour the simmering hot distilled water into the jar and let steep for up to 1 hour, or until cool. Strain and set aside. If you’re using dried thyme, you may only need to steep it for 30 minutes, otherwise the water may turn darker and discolor the soap. Dried thyme is stronger than fresh thyme.
